Welcome new committer: Cosmin Stanciu

It is my pleasure to share that the OpenWhisk PPMC
has elected Cosmin Stanciu as a Committer,
based on his ongoing and valuable contributions to the project,
especially around user events, monitoring and kubernetes deployment.

Cosmin has accepted the invitation.

Please join me in welcoming Cosmin to his new role on the project !

Being a committer enables easier contribution to the project
since there is no need to go via the patch submission process.
This should enable better productivity.
Being a PMC member enables assistance with the management
and to guide the direction of the project.
